The view is what makes this home, located on a cul-de-sac, the most exceptional in the neighborhood. Views of the water will provide a soothing end of your day. Also, lounge on your covered patio for even more enjoyment. This home was completed in 2024, with seller upgrades for a feel of luxury. The kitchen, with views of the water, features an island, granite and natural stone countertops, a walk-in pantry, and commercial grade range and vent hood. The family room features a bar area.The primary bedroom, with water views, flows into a luxurious primary bathroom with a separate tub and shower, and a huge 9 X 18 walk-in closet. The grand staircase leads to 2 bedrooms, 1 bath, a media room, which with the open concept, provides more views of the water. In the front of the home are also a formal living and dining room. More space for family gatherings and entertaining. A large floored attic provides more storage. Come enjoy the view, the spacious surroundings, and the feeling of home.

Living in Texas means access to four of the nation’s most dynamic metro economies — Dallas–Fort Worth’s corporate and logistics powerhouse, Houston’s global energy and medical hub, Austin’s tech-driven and culturally iconic Live Music Capital of the World, and San Antonio’s historic yet steadily expanding military and healthcare center. The state blends economic scale with cultural significance, rooted in independence, entrepreneurship, and a strong sense of place — from Friday night football to world-renowned barbecue and music festivals. For homebuyers, Texas offers comparatively attainable housing, no personal income tax, and master-planned communities built around space and convenience; for investors, continued population growth, business relocation, and diversified industries create sustained demand across urban cores, suburbs, and emerging secondary markets.
